Pajutee — Miniature Giraffe Sculpture of clay and fiber

Description This is one of the largest dollhouse miniature 1:12 scale sculptures I have completed to date.  This giraffe was created for an African Safari exhibit and stands at 11 inches in height.  Sculpt was freehand-formed using BeeSputty clay over a wire & foil armature, then painted & dressed in powder-fine flock.  The coat pattern was drawn in pencil, then painted onto the surface.  Next the white flock was applied using glue.  After drying, the russet brown flock was applied and the entire piece was cleaned of loose fibers using tweezers & masking tape.
